[0022] The preferred embodiments of the present invention will be described below with reference to the drawings. Those skilled in the art should understand that these embodiments are only used to explain the technical principles of the present invention and are not intended to limit the protection scope of the present invention.

[0023] In general, the method of the present invention includes three sets of progressive protection mechanisms, namely, an interlocking protection mechanism before the action is executed, an exception handling mechanism during the execution of the action, and a maintenance mechanism when the exception cannot be eliminated. Specifically, the basic idea of ​​the interlock protection mechanism is to determine whether the pre-action of the action is completed and whether there are obstacles to the execution of the action before the switching system performs each action, and determine whether to perform a specific action based on the result of the judgment....

Abstract

The invention relates to operation of a battery swap station and specifically provides a battery swap station battery swap system action abnormity processing method, which is used for preventing abnormity in the battery swap execution process as far as possible and processing the abnormity according to abnormity properties when abnormity occurs. The method comprises the following steps: under the condition of receiving an execution instruction for a specific action, judging whether front actions of the specific action are finished and judging whether an obstacle in executing the specific action exists, and selectively executing the specific action according to the judgment result; and when executing the specific action and if abnormity occurs in the execution process, carrying out recovery or request for human intervention according to the property of the abnormity. The action abnormity processing method can realize logical interlock protection in the battery swap execution process to prevent abnormity as far as possible, and carry out selective processing according to the property of the abnormity when the abnormity occurs, thereby ensuring equipment, vehicle and personal safety in the battery swap process.

Description

technical field [0001] The present invention relates to the technical field of safety of a battery swapping station, in particular to a method for processing abnormal operation of a battery swapping system of a battery swapping station. Background technique [0002] With the rapid development of electric vehicles in recent years, the mileage concern of electric vehicles has always been an urgent problem to be solved in the industry. Therefore, whether electric vehicles can provide a charging experience that surpasses that of fuel vehicles is an important factor affecting the future development and popularization of electric vehicles. [0003] Among the many power-on methods, the power-swapping method is a fast, convenient and safe method. The battery swap station usually consists of a parking platform, a battery replacement trolley, a battery compartment storage and charging rack, a battery compartment lift, and other auxiliary equipment.
